Advertisement
Guest User

Untitled

a guest
Dec 23rd, 2017
71
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
SAS 0.50 KB | None | 0 0
  1. proc optmodel;/*zadanie 4 s.195*/
  2. num m=2;
  3. num n=3;
  4. num c{i in 1..m, j in 1..n}=[
  5. 7   2   1
  6. 1   4   6
  7. ];
  8. num wsp{i in 0..m, j in 1..n}=[
  9. 80 60 50
  10. -8 -8 --4
  11. 0.25 0.5 0.2
  12. ];
  13. num podaz{i in 1..m}=[15 15];
  14. var x{i in 1..m, j in 1..n} >=0;
  15. var z{j in 1..n} >=0;
  16. min koszt=sum{i in 1..m, j in 1..n}c[i,j]*x[i,j]
  17. +sum{j in 1..n}(wsp[0,j]+wsp[1,j]*z[j]+wsp[2,j]*z[j]**2);
  18. con warPodaz{i in 1..m}: sum{j in 1..n}x[i,j]<=podaz[i];
  19. con warPopyt{j in 1..n}: sum{i in 1..m}x[i,j]=z[j];
  20. solve;
  21. print x z;
  22. quit;
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ement